What is a Loan Payment Calculator Excel?

A loan payment calculator excel is a powerful online tool designed to simulate the functionality of a sophisticated loan amortization spreadsheet. It allows individuals and businesses to quickly and accurately determine their periodic loan payments, typically monthly, based on the principal loan amount, annual interest rate, and loan term. The “excel” in its name signifies its ability to perform complex financial calculations, much like the PMT function in Microsoft Excel, providing a detailed breakdown of principal and interest over the life of the loan.

This type of calculator is indispensable for anyone considering taking out a loan, whether it’s a mortgage, auto loan, personal loan, or business loan. It helps in understanding the financial commitment involved before signing any agreements.

Common Misconceptions About Loan Payment Calculators

While incredibly useful, there are a few common misconceptions about using a loan payment calculator excel:

  • It’s a Loan Approval Tool: This calculator estimates payments; it does not guarantee loan approval or specific interest rates. Actual rates depend on creditworthiness and market conditions.
  • It Includes All Fees: Most basic calculators only factor in principal and interest. They typically do not include closing costs, origination fees, property taxes, or insurance (for mortgages), which can significantly impact the total cost.
  • Interest Rate is Always Fixed: Many loans, especially mortgages, can have variable interest rates. This calculator usually assumes a fixed rate unless specified otherwise.
  • Payments are Always Monthly: While monthly is common, loans can have bi-weekly, weekly, or even quarterly payments. Our loan payment calculator excel allows you to adjust this.

Loan Payment Calculator Excel Formula and Mathematical Explanation

The core of any loan payment calculator excel lies in its mathematical formula, which is derived from the principles of compound interest and annuities. Understanding this formula helps demystify how your payments are structured.

Step-by-Step Derivation of the Loan Payment Formula

The formula used to calculate the fixed periodic payment for a fully amortizing loan is:

Pmt = [ P * r * (1 + r)^n ] / [ (1 + r)^n – 1 ]

Let’s break down each component:

  1. Identify Variables: First, we need the principal loan amount (P), the annual interest rate, and the loan term.
  2. Calculate Periodic Interest Rate (r): The annual interest rate needs to be converted to a periodic rate based on the payment frequency. If the annual rate is 4.5% and payments are monthly, the periodic rate is 4.5% / 12.
  3. Calculate Total Number of Payments (n): The loan term in years needs to be converted to the total number of payments. For a 30-year loan with monthly payments, n = 30 * 12 = 360.
  4. Apply the Formula: Plug these values into the formula. The numerator represents the portion of the payment that covers both principal and interest, while the denominator adjusts for the time value of money over the loan term.

This formula ensures that by the end of the loan term, the entire principal amount, plus all accrued interest, has been repaid through equal periodic payments.

Variable Explanations

Key Variables in Loan Payment Calculation
Variable Meaning Unit Typical Range
P (Principal) The initial amount of money borrowed. Currency ($) $1,000 – $1,000,000+
r (Periodic Interest Rate) The interest rate applied per payment period. (Annual Rate / Payments per Year) Decimal (e.g., 0.00375 for 0.375%) 0.001 – 0.015 (per month)
n (Total Number of Payments) The total count of payments over the loan’s lifetime. (Loan Term in Years * Payments per Year) Number of Payments 12 – 720 (1-60 years, monthly)
Pmt (Periodic Payment) The fixed amount paid each period (e.g., monthly payment). Currency ($) Varies widely

Practical Examples (Real-World Use Cases)

To illustrate the power of a loan payment calculator excel, let’s look at a couple of practical scenarios.

Example 1: Buying a New Car

Sarah wants to buy a new car. The car costs $30,000, and she plans to finance it over 5 years (60 months) at an annual interest rate of 6.5%.

  • Loan Amount (P): $30,000
  • Annual Interest Rate: 6.5%
  • Loan Term (Years): 5
  • Payment Frequency: Monthly (12 payments per year)

Using the loan payment calculator excel:

  • Periodic Interest Rate (r): 0.065 / 12 = 0.00541667
  • Total Number of Payments (n): 5 * 12 = 60
  • Calculated Monthly Payment: Approximately $587.90
  • Total Amount Paid: $587.90 * 60 = $35,274.00
  • Total Interest Paid: $35,274.00 – $30,000 = $5,274.00

Financial Interpretation: Sarah’s monthly car payment will be $587.90. Over five years, she will pay an additional $5,274 in interest, making the total cost of the car $35,274. This helps her budget and decide if this car is within her financial reach.

Example 2: Refinancing a Mortgage

David is considering refinancing his remaining mortgage balance of $250,000. He has 20 years left on his current loan, but he found a new lender offering a 3.8% annual interest rate for a new 15-year term.

  • Loan Amount (P): $250,000
  • Annual Interest Rate: 3.8%
  • Loan Term (Years): 15
  • Payment Frequency: Monthly (12 payments per year)

Using the loan payment calculator excel:

  • Periodic Interest Rate (r): 0.038 / 12 = 0.00316667
  • Total Number of Payments (n): 15 * 12 = 180
  • Calculated Monthly Payment: Approximately $1,817.00
  • Total Amount Paid: $1,817.00 * 180 = $327,060.00
  • Total Interest Paid: $327,060.00 – $250,000 = $77,060.00

Financial Interpretation: David’s new monthly payment would be $1,817.00. While this might be higher than his previous payment (due to the shorter term), he would save significantly on total interest over the life of the loan compared to his original 20-year term. This loan payment calculator excel helps him weigh the trade-offs between a higher monthly payment and lower overall interest costs.

Key Factors That Affect Loan Payment Calculator Excel Results

Several critical factors influence the outcome of a loan payment calculator excel. Understanding these can help you optimize your borrowing strategy and manage your debt more effectively.

  1. Principal Loan Amount: This is the most direct factor. A larger loan amount will always result in higher periodic payments and greater total interest paid, assuming all other factors remain constant. Reducing the principal through a larger down payment is a powerful way to lower your financial burden.
  2. Annual Interest Rate: The interest rate is a significant determinant of the total cost of your loan. Even a small difference in the annual percentage rate (APR) can lead to substantial savings or additional costs over the loan’s term. Higher rates mean higher payments and more interest. This is why comparing rates is crucial when using a loan payment calculator excel.
  3. Loan Term (Duration): The length of time you have to repay the loan has a dual impact. A longer loan term (e.g., 30 years vs. 15 years for a mortgage) typically results in lower periodic payments, making the loan seem more affordable monthly. However, it also means you pay significantly more in total interest over the life of the loan. Conversely, a shorter term leads to higher periodic payments but much lower total interest.
  4. Payment Frequency: While less impactful than rate or term, how often you make payments can slightly alter the total interest paid. More frequent payments (e.g., bi-weekly instead of monthly) can sometimes reduce the total interest because you’re paying down the principal faster, leading to less interest accruing between payments. Our loan payment calculator excel accounts for this.
  5. Credit Score: Although not a direct input into the calculator, your credit score heavily influences the annual interest rate you qualify for. Lenders offer lower rates to borrowers with excellent credit, as they are perceived as lower risk. A higher credit score can significantly reduce your loan payments and total interest.
  6. Loan Type and Lender Fees: Different loan types (e.g., secured vs. unsecured, fixed-rate vs. adjustable-rate) come with varying risk profiles and associated fees. While the calculator focuses on principal and interest, remember that origination fees, closing costs, and other charges can add to the overall cost of borrowing. Always factor these into your total financial planning.

Frequently Asked Questions (FAQ)

Q: How accurate is this loan payment calculator excel compared to a bank’s calculation?

A: Our loan payment calculator excel uses the standard amortization formula, which is the same mathematical basis banks and financial institutions use. Therefore, the principal and interest calculations should be highly accurate. Discrepancies might arise from additional fees, insurance, or taxes that banks might bundle into a “total monthly payment” but are not part of the core loan amortization.

Q: Can I use this calculator for both fixed-rate and adjustable-rate loans?

A: This loan payment calculator excel is primarily designed for fixed-rate loans, where the interest rate remains constant throughout the loan term. For adjustable-rate mortgages (ARMs), you can use it to calculate payments for each fixed period, but it won’t predict future rate changes or their impact on payments.

Q: What if I want to make extra payments? How does that affect the results?

A: This calculator assumes fixed, regular payments. Making extra payments directly towards the principal will reduce your loan term and total interest paid. While this calculator doesn’t model extra payments directly, you can use it to see how a lower principal balance (after an extra payment) would affect future payments if you were to re-amortize the loan.

Q: Why is the “Total Interest Paid” so high for long-term loans?

A: Interest accrues on the outstanding principal balance. For long-term loans, especially at the beginning, a larger portion of your payment goes towards interest because the principal balance is still high. Over many years, this cumulative interest can become a significant amount. This is a key insight provided by a loan payment calculator excel.

Q: Does the payment frequency really make a difference?

A: Yes, it can. While the difference might seem small on a per-payment basis, making more frequent payments (e.g., bi-weekly instead of monthly) means you make an extra full month’s payment each year (26 bi-weekly payments vs. 12 monthly payments). This accelerates principal reduction, leading to less interest accruing over the loan’s life and a slightly shorter loan term.

Q: Can I use this calculator for business loans?

A: Absolutely. As long as the business loan follows a standard amortizing structure with a fixed principal, interest rate, and term, this loan payment calculator excel will provide accurate payment estimates.

Q: What is an amortization schedule and why is it important?

A: An amortization schedule is a table detailing each periodic payment of an amortizing loan. It shows how much of each payment goes towards interest, how much goes towards principal, and the remaining balance after each payment. It’s crucial for understanding how your loan is paid off and for financial planning, a feature often found in a detailed loan payment calculator excel.
